March 11, 20242 yr #1 This tunic is interesting to me for a number of reasons, and also a bit of a head scratcher. The blouse is executed in a forest green and is quilted inside, so I am quite sure it would have provided plenty of warmth for the Lieutenant that wore it. It is extremely well tailored. The rank devices denote. 1st Lieutenant, but on close inspection you can see that there was once a star in the center of each tab. I assume that the rank tabs have been converted from a pair of Captain’s tabs. The tunic is extremely small in size. Above the wearer’s right pocket flap is the standard “M” which is executed in dark blue felt. I am having a bit of difficulty determining branch. I believe that black is Military Police and it is far too dark for aviation. I’m not sure what I am missing here. Finally, you can see that there is an opening at the waist to allow for a dagger or sword. I would appreciate any and all comments. Thanks for looking. Allan
March 11, 20242 yr #2 Hi Allan, A very nice early tunic with the high collar and no cuff stripes. I don"t recall what the blue squiggle branch over the pocket patch represents but you are correct it is not black for MP. I would read the collar tabs as him being promoted from a one star to a two star change-up. The tunic has his name tag inside. Did you look for a tailor label in the pockets? A Nice tunic. George
